1. Floating Shelves ππΏ
Floating shelves are perfect for displaying your favorite books, plants, or decorative pieces.
By installing them on your walls, you free up floor space while creating a modern and stylish display.
Plus, theyβre great for small spaces!
2. Under-Bed Storage Drawers ποΈποΈ
Maximize the space under your bed with storage drawers or bins.
Perfect for storing off-season clothing, extra bedding, or shoes, under-bed storage is a game-changer, keeping things organized and out of sight.
3. Over-the-Door Hooks πͺπ
Install hooks on the backs of doors to hang accessories, bags, hats, or towels.
These hooks keep your essentials organized and easily accessible while saving space in your closet or entryway.
4. Built-In Pantry Shelves π΄π¦
Organize your kitchen pantry with custom-built shelves.
Whether itβs for canned goods, dry foods, or spices, these shelves provide a neat and easily accessible way to store your kitchen essentials.
5. Corner Bookshelves ππ
Use corner spaces effectively by adding triangular or custom-built corner bookshelves.
Theyβre perfect for storing books, plants, or even small decor items, all while utilizing an often-neglected area of the room.
6. Wall-Mounted Pegboards π§π¨
A wall-mounted pegboard is an excellent storage idea for kitchens, craft rooms, or garages.
You can hang tools, utensils, craft supplies, or anything else that needs organization.
This is a functional and customizable storage solution!
7. Storage Ottomans ποΈπ¦
Ottomans with hidden compartments are an easy way to store blankets, magazines, or remote controls.
Plus, they provide additional seating in your living room or bedroom.
Itβs a stylish and practical storage option.
8. Under-Sink Storage Solutions πΏπ§΄
The area under your sink can easily become cluttered with toiletries and cleaning supplies.
Use stackable bins, shelves, or pull-out drawers to keep everything neatly stored and accessible.
9. Overhead Garage Storage ππ οΈ
Take advantage of unused ceiling space in your garage by installing overhead storage racks.
Theyβre great for storing seasonal items, sports equipment, and bulky items that need to be stored out of the way.
10. Entryway Console Tables πͺπ¬
An entryway console table can store keys, mail, shoes, and bags while adding a stylish touch to your homeβs entrance.
Choose one with drawers or baskets to keep everything neat and tidy.
11. Under-Cabinet Kitchen Storage π½οΈπ₯
Maximize your kitchen storage by adding pull-out shelves, lazy Susans, or stackable baskets inside cabinets.
These are perfect for organizing pots, pans, and pantry items efficiently.
12. Wall-Mounted Spice Racks πΏπΎ
Keep your spices organized by installing a wall-mounted spice rack in your kitchen.
Not only does it save cabinet space, but it also makes it easier to find the spices you need while cooking!
13. Under-Stair Storage πͺπ
Turn the often-unused space under your stairs into a closet, shelves, or storage area.
This is a great way to store shoes, coats, or household items that need to be kept out of sight.
14. Modular Closet Organizers ππ
Modular closet organizers can be adjusted to fit your needs, offering customizable storage with shelves, drawers, and hanging rods.
Perfect for maximizing closet space!
15. Wall-Mounted Towel Racks ππ§Ό
Install towel racks on your bathroom wall to keep towels organized and dry.
This is an easy and functional solution for bathrooms of any size.
16. Under-Cabinet Lighting with Storage π‘π
Combine lighting with storage solutions under cabinets to illuminate your kitchen or bathroom and maximize counter space.
Itβs an easy way to brighten up your space while keeping things organized.
17. Overhead Pot Racks π³π₯
An overhead pot rack is a great solution for saving cabinet space in the kitchen.
Hang your pots and pans from the ceiling for easy access and a touch of rustic charm.
18. Under-Shelf Storage Baskets π½οΈπ§΄
Attach baskets to the underside of kitchen shelves to store condiments, spices, or cleaning supplies.
This maximizes vertical space, making it easy to access frequently used items.
19. Wall-Mounted Entryway Hooks π§₯π
Install hooks in your entryway to hang coats, bags, or hats.
This is a great way to keep the area neat and organized, especially if you have a small space.
20. Under-Cabinet Bathroom Storage π§΄π
Use organizers or pull-out drawers under bathroom sinks to store toiletries and cleaning products.
Itβs an efficient way to maximize your bathroom storage.
21. Wall-Mounted Utensil Racks π½οΈπͺ
Hanging your kitchen utensils on wall-mounted racks keeps them organized and easily accessible.
You can store everything from cooking spoons to knives, all within reach!
22. Storage Bins with Labels π·οΈπ¦
Label your storage bins to keep everything organized and easy to find.
These bins can be stacked in closets, garages, or under your bed to hold seasonal items, craft supplies, or paperwork.
23. Vertical Shoe Rack π π
Install a vertical shoe rack in your closet or entryway to keep shoes organized and off the floor.
This compact storage solution allows you to store multiple pairs without taking up much space.
24. Wall-Mounted Bike Rack π²βοΈ
If youβre a cyclist, a wall-mounted bike rack is a perfect solution to free up floor space in your garage or hallway.
It keeps your bike safe and accessible without taking up precious real estate.
25. Expandable Drawer Dividers π΄πͺ
Use expandable dividers in kitchen drawers to keep utensils, cutlery, and tools neatly organized.
These dividers allow you to adjust the size to fit the contents of your drawer perfectly.
26. Laundry Room Storage π§Ίπ
Maximize your laundry room storage with wall-mounted shelves, baskets, and racks.
You can keep detergents, cleaning supplies, and even clothes hampers neatly stored and organized.
27. Under-Stair Pantry π₯π
Turn the unused space under your stairs into a compact pantry.
Install shelves or racks to store canned goods, dry foods, or other kitchen essentials.
